There aren't 999 unique moons. The game allows you to buy a bunch of generic moons, to both allow players to unlock some end game content without getting some moons the traditional way if they desire (I don't recommend this, as the game has more than enough manageable moons to collect and you really only need 500 to see the vast majority of the game's content) and there's also a small reward for having a total of 999 moons. I wouldn't buy any extra moons (beyond the first moon you purchase in each kingdom) until you've gotten 100% of the moons in the game world. Otherwise, you're just wasting money.
